Abstract

The invention relates to an anti-ultraviolet leather polish. The anti-ultraviolet leather polish comprises the following components in parts by weight: 50-80 parts of beeswax, 2-8 parts of anti-ultraviolet agent, 5-7 parts of anionic surface active agent, 1.5-10 parts of silicone oil, 0.1-1 part of essence and 20-30 parts of water. The product has a wide range of applications and is suitable for leather shoes, leather clothing, leather sofas and the like; the product can prevent ultraviolet rays, upgrade the UPF (ultraviolet protection factor) value of leather, reduce the harm of the ultraviolet rays to human bodies and realize strong dispersivity, excellent illumination stability and fastness, stable performances and no irritation to the human bodies; the product does not contain phosphates, is strong in penetration and nourishing and can prevent ageing and cracking; and cleaning, curing and polishing can be completed once, and the use is convenient.

Summary of the invention
The invention provides a kind of antiultraviolet leather polish, the range of application that solves in the existing leather nursing lustering agent technology is little, the glazing DeGrain, can not antiultraviolet etc. technical problem.
The present invention is by the following technical solutions: a kind of antiultraviolet leather polish, its composition take the parts by weight representation as:
Beeswax 50-80;
Ultraviolet screener 2-8;
Anion surfactant 5-7;
Silica gel oil 1.5-10;
Essence 0.1-1;
Water 20-30.
As a kind of optimal technical scheme of the present invention: described beeswax mainly contains acids, free fatty acids, the pure and mild carbohydrate of free-fat.
As a kind of optimal technical scheme of the present invention: described ultraviolet screener adopts one or more mixtures among UV 100, UV 477 or the KS 120, and the pH value is 6-8.
As a kind of optimal technical scheme of the present invention: described anion surfactant is one or more mixtures among K12 or the RQ-636.

Embodiment
The below is described in further detail the specific embodiment of the present invention:
Embodiment 1:
The first step: take by weighing various raw materials according to weight fraction ratio hereinafter described:
Beeswax 50 Guangzhous outstanding standing grain apiculture company limited;
Good fortune river in Shangdong Province, ultraviolet screener 2 trade names KS-120 Xiamen City chemistry company limited;
Anion surfactant 5 trade names RQ636 Shenzhen Rong Qiang Science and Technology Ltd.s;
Oceanic rise plumage wrapping mechanism Materials Co., Ltd on the silica gel oil 1.5;
Essence 0.1 Dongguan City method fragrance Lai Er essence and flavoring agent company limited;
Water 20.
Second step: above-mentioned raw materials is put into reactor, is 500-800 rev/min stirrer mixing 4-7 minute with rotating speed, and various compositions are uniformly dispersed;
The 3rd step: above-mentioned abundant mixed material is put into can in the aerosol filling machine.

The scope of application: leather shoes, fur clothing, chaparajos, skin overcoat, fur coat, cortex sofa or imitation leather goods.
Using method: leather products is cleaned up, apart from surperficial 25-30cm spray 2-3 time, 20 ℃ of lower placements 24 hours, dry after 60 ℃ of water temperatures are washed.
